First off, let's talk about what polyurea is. Polyurea is a type of elastomer that's formed by the reaction of an isocyanate component and a synthetic resin blend component. It's known for its high performance and versatility. In the world of sports products, polyurea has become a go - to material for a lot of reasons, and scratch resistance is definitely one of them.

How Polyurea Offers Scratch Resistance

Polyurea has some unique properties that make it highly scratch - resistant. One of the key factors is its high cross - linking density. The cross - linking in polyurea creates a strong and dense molecular structure. This structure acts like a shield, preventing scratches from easily penetrating the surface of the material.

Another important property is its elasticity. Polyurea is very elastic, which means it can stretch and deform under pressure without breaking. When a sharp object tries to scratch the polyurea surface, the material can absorb the impact and bounce back to its original shape, reducing the likelihood of a scratch.

In addition, polyurea has excellent adhesion properties. When it's applied to a sports product, it forms a strong bond with the substrate. This bond not only ensures that the polyurea coating stays in place but also provides an extra layer of protection against scratches. The polyurea coating can act as a buffer between the substrate and the outside environment, shielding the substrate from scratches.

Comparing Polyurea with Other Materials

When it comes to scratch resistance in sports products, polyurea outperforms many other materials. For example, compared to traditional plastics, polyurea is much more scratch - resistant. Plastics can easily get scratched, especially when they come into contact with sharp objects or rough surfaces. On the other hand, polyurea's high cross - linking density and elasticity make it much more durable in the face of scratching.

Rubber is another common material used in sports products. While rubber has some degree of elasticity, it doesn't have the same level of scratch resistance as polyurea. Rubber can be easily scratched and worn down over time, especially in high - friction situations. Polyurea, with its strong molecular structure and excellent adhesion, offers better protection against scratches.
